PUBLIC CONVOCATION---THE RESPONSIBLE CONDUCT OF SCIENCE NIH GUIDE, Volume 23, Number 15, April 15, 1994 P.T. Keywords: National Academy of Sciences Meeting Date: June 6 and 7, 1994 The National Academy of Sciences, the National Academy of Engineering, and the Institute of Medicine are committed to bringing matters of responsible conduct to the full attention of participants in the scientific and engineering enterprise. In pursuit of that goal, the Academy complex will hold a major public convocation on the conduct of science on June 6 and 7, 1994. The meeting will review progress made by government, universities, and other institutions in addressing matters related to the conduct of science and engineering, including the handling of allegations of misconduct and the creation of educational programs for new and established investigators. The meeting will also examine next steps to ensure that the highest standards of conduct in science are maintained. Participants in the convocation will include scientists and engineers, leaders of professional societies, research and university administrators, science educators, the media, and decisionmakers in the Administration, Congress, and industry. Previous studies by panels formed by the Institute of Medicine and the Committee on Science, Engineering, and Public Policy have been supported by the National Institutes of Health and other Federal agencies, as well as private funds. The current requirement for instruction in the responsible conduct of research for trainees supported by NIH-funded institutional research training grants supports some of the recommendations from those panels.
